Program Overview
Module 1: Introduction to Insight Selling
Duration estimate: 2 weeks
Defining insight selling vs. traditional sales
Core principles of consultative engagement
Understanding buyer psychology and motivation
Module 2: Uncovering Hidden Customer Needs
Duration: 2 weeks
Active listening and diagnostic questioning
Identifying pain points in complex buyer environments
Mapping customer decision-making processes
Module 3: Structuring Value-Based Propositions
Duration: 2 weeks
Building compelling narratives around business impact
Quantifying value in financial and operational terms
Aligning solutions with strategic customer goals
Module 4: Adapting to Dynamic Markets
Duration: 2 weeks
Navigating cultural nuances in US and Indian markets
Overcoming initial buyer resistance
Sustaining engagement through iterative value delivery

Supplementary Resources
Book: Read "The Challenger Sale" by Brent Adamson and Matthew Dixon to deepen understanding of the model introduced in the course and explore real-world case studies.
Tool: Use a CRM like HubSpot or Salesforce to track insight-based interactions and measure changes in engagement quality over time.
Follow-up: Enroll in advanced negotiation or sales leadership courses to build on foundational skills and expand strategic capabilities.
Reference: Consult SPIN Selling by Neil Rackham for additional questioning frameworks that complement the course’s discovery techniques.
Common Pitfalls
Pitfall: Relying too heavily on scripts instead of adapting insights organically. Learners should focus on principles, not memorization, to maintain authenticity in customer conversations.
Pitfall: Skipping practice due to time constraints. Without deliberate application, concepts remain theoretical and fail to translate into improved performance.
Pitfall: Underestimating cultural nuances in messaging. Even small differences in communication style can impact credibility, especially in cross-border sales contexts.
